Curriculum Vitae

Rafly Hafizin
Media Social
Saya adalah lulusan dari Universitas Sriwijaya Palembang jurusan Teknik Informatika. Saya dapat mengoperasikan komputer atau laptop dengan baik, mengoperasikan microsoft excel dan microsoft word.Selain keahlian teknis saya juga memiliki kemampuan non teknis seperti manajemen dokumen, pengelolaan file digital, beradaptasi dengan cepat,saya juga dapat berkomunikasi dengan baik dan juga bekerja dalam tim maupun individu.Dengan motivasi yang tinggi untuk terus belajar dan berkembang, serta latar belakang pendidikan saya dari jurusan Teknik Informatika, saya yakin saya dapat berkontribusi dalam tim dan membawa kontribusi positif dalam mencapai tujuan perusahaan.
Agustus 2022
Universitas Sriwijaya
S1 • Teknik Informatika • IPK 3.10
Maret 2023 - April 2023
Devops Engineer
Cilsy Fiolution Indonesia • Magang
1. Monitoring infrastruktur resource aplikasi web
2. Membuat laporan hasil monitoring
Desember 2019 - Januari 2020
Web Development
PT Kereta Api Indonesia (Persero) • Magang
Membuat tampilan untuk aplikasi web inventaris barang untuk memantau barang masuk dan barang keluar yang akan dipakai di perusahaan PT KAI Divre III Plaju Palembang
Februari 2023
Bootcamp Devops Engineer
PT Cilsy Fiolution Indonesia • 01/0257/CR-DO/CILSYFIOLUTION/II/2023
Migrasi Infrastruktur dari on-Premise ke AWS Cloud (Big Project Sekolah Digital Cilsy)
1.Membuat design topologi infrastruktur untuk projek yang akan dibuat mulai dari environment 2.staging dan production. Version Control System menggunakan Github untuk repository project.
3.Menggunakan cloud provider AWS menggunakan service seperti EC2 instance, AWS EKS Cluster, RDS AWS.
4.Membuat EC2 instance untuk server jenkins menggunakan terraform
5.Mengimplementasikan docker sebagai containerization untuk build image aplikasi fullstack javascript todo-list berbasis web yang akan dideploy ke server dan mengimplementasikan 6.Kubernetes sebagai orchestration untuk melakukan deployment ke server mulai dari environment staging lalu ke production.
7.Mengimplementasikan CI/CD menggunakan Jenkins multi branch pipeline untuk auto build 8.image dan push ke dockerhub jika ada push terbaru dari repository dan juga menampilkan notifikasi di slack hasil build dari Jenkins dan mengimplementasikan KEEL untuk auto deployment pada Kubernetes jika ada build terbaru.
9.Mengekspos service cluster menggunakan Nginx Ingress Controller.
10.Migrasi database production ke RDS AWS.
11.Menggunakan Cloudflare sebagai DNS management.
12.Menggunakan loki,promtail dan grafana untuk melakukan logging dan monitoring.
13.Menggunakan Slack untuk melihat notifikasi dari hasil build Jenkins dan notifikasi auto deployment KEEL.
Media
Juli 2022
Belajar Jaringan Komputer untuk Pemula
Dicoding Indonesia • 81P2G59NNPOY
Mempelajari dasar-dasar jaringan komputer untuk pemula
Media
Juni 2022
Belajar Dasar-Dasar DevOps
Dicoding Indonesia • MRZMD80KKZYQ
Mempelajari Dasar-Dasar Devops